<rt id="bn8ez"></rt>
<label id="bn8ez"></label>

  • <span id="bn8ez"></span>

    <label id="bn8ez"><meter id="bn8ez"></meter></label>

    隨筆 - 20  文章 - 8  trackbacks - 0
    <2007年5月>
    293012345
    6789101112
    13141516171819
    20212223242526
    272829303112
    3456789

    常用鏈接

    留言簿(1)

    隨筆分類

    隨筆檔案

    搜索

    •  

    最新評論

    閱讀排行榜

    評論排行榜

    在新窗口中打開鏈接很簡單,下面的javascript即可完成功能.
    window.open ("page.html", "newwindow", "height=100, width=100, top=0, left=0,toolbar=no, menubar=no, scrollbars=no,

    resizable=no, location=no, status=no")

    今天有個比較特別的需求,為頁面中動態生成的html元素a添加響應。開始想為a元素添加onclick響應函數??墒怯捎诜笗灷鲜菍?br>
    href.onclick="javascript:window.open()",實驗半天也沒有半點進展。后來同事添加了一個函數,修改href.href="javascript:newwindow

    ()",可以在新窗口中打開了。由于一心想修改onclick,仔細回憶了以下javascript的模型,發現自己試圖為onclick賦值的方法錯了。由于

    javascript中不管是變量還是函數都是對象,要想為onclick賦值,需要賦值一個函數對象。所以需要寫成href.onclick=hrefOnClick。下面是

    測試用的代碼:
    <html>
    <head />
    <body>
    <script language="javascript">
    <!--
    function hrefOnClick(){
        window.open("http://google.com.cn", "", "");
    }
    function hrefHref(url){
        window.open(url, "", "");
    }

    var div;
    div = document.createElement("DIV");

    var href;

    href = document.createElement("a");
    href.style.color = "black";
    href.style.fontFamily = "宋體";
    href.style.fontSize  = "9pt";
    href.style.backgroundColor = "#F1FF77";
    href.style.textDecoration="none";
    href.innerHTML = "點擊這個鏈接在新窗口中打開鏈接,修改href";
    href.href = "javascript:hrefHref('http://google.com.cn')";
    href.target = "_top";
    div.appendChild(href);

    div.appendChild(document.createElement("br"));

    href = document.createElement("a");
    href.style.color = "black";
    href.style.fontFamily = "宋體";
    href.style.fontSize  = "9pt";
    href.style.backgroundColor = "#F1FF77";
    href.style.textDecoration="none";
    href.innerHTML = "點擊這個鏈接在新窗口中打開鏈接,修改onclick";
    href.href = "#";
    href.onclick = hrefOnClick;
    div.appendChild(href);

    document.body.appendChild(div);
    //document.body.insertAdjacentElement("afterBegin",div);

    -->
    </script>
    </body>
    </html>
    posted on 2007-05-29 15:21 卜清楚 閱讀(2965) 評論(0)  編輯  收藏 所屬分類: javascript

    只有注冊用戶登錄后才能發表評論。


    網站導航:
     
    主站蜘蛛池模板: 亚洲伊人久久大香线蕉结合| 日本高清免费不卡在线| 99免费在线视频| 亚洲av无码一区二区三区网站| 亚洲国产美女福利直播秀一区二区| 亚洲中文字幕乱码熟女在线| 中文在线免费看视频| 成人A级毛片免费观看AV网站| 亚洲男人的天堂一区二区| 亚洲欧洲日产韩国在线| a色毛片免费视频| 亚洲狠狠婷婷综合久久蜜芽| a级毛片100部免费观看| 国产亚洲?V无码?V男人的天堂| 免费观看午夜在线欧差毛片| 亚洲人成网站在线观看播放动漫| 国产在线精品免费aaa片| 亚洲精品无码永久在线观看| 国产亚洲综合一区二区三区| a一级爱做片免费| 二级毛片免费观看全程| 午夜免费福利网站| 国产精品免费观看| 无码国产精品一区二区免费16| 亚洲精品美女久久久久99| 午夜免费啪视频在线观看| 亚洲AV乱码久久精品蜜桃| 999久久久免费精品播放| 亚洲国产精品无码久久SM | 国产成人亚洲精品青草天美| 国产亚洲精品无码专区| 久久免费精彩视频| 免费日本一区二区| 8888四色奇米在线观看免费看| 亚洲成综合人影院在院播放| 免费视频中文字幕| 久久丫精品国产亚洲av不卡| 18观看免费永久视频| 亚洲精品永久在线观看| 国产亚洲人成网站在线观看不卡| 久久水蜜桃亚洲AV无码精品|